To run a business, you need to get yourself a few licenses and permits from your state or county. The specific licenses and permits you’ll need depend on what state you reside and how you operate your company. If you’re selling your shirts exclusively online, you might not require a sales tax permit. Regardless of where your house is and just how you sell your merchandise, you’ll need to register your company with all the IRS and purchase an Employer Identification Number, or EIN. Check with your local government to view what else you’ll need.
